Another year of outstanding A Level success at Newcastle High School for Girls
Sixth Form pupils at Newcastle High School for Girls (NHSG) are celebrating another phenomenal year this A Level results day with around half of all grades being at A* to A and an impressive nine percentage point leap at A * – B grades compared to 2023 bucking national trends.
Demonstrating its continued upward academic trajectory in delivering outstanding results for its pupils, NHSG has today reported that 80% of grades are at A* to B, 95% at grades A – C and a 100% pass rate.

Taking up the role earlier this year, NHSG Head, Amanda Hardie, said: “I am incredibly pleased with this summer’s A Level results and so delighted for each and every girl as they fulfil their dreams and ambitions and start on the next stage of their life. It’s always a joy to see the girls nerves replaced with delight when they open their results and they can finally reap the rewards of all the hard work they’ve put in during the last two years. Our whole staff team is equally thrilled to see the girls’ achievements as well as the percentage point leap at A* – B which is recognition for the approach we are taking at NHSG to further strengthen our academic standing.”

Underneath the headline statistics lay exceptional individual achievements from pupils at the school which will see girls heading to universities across the UK as well as overseas.
